A few days before the deadline, Jim Mulhern, president and CEO of the National Milk Producers … WebBringing food products into the Netherlands from the UK Whenever you bring food products into the Netherlands, they will be subject to Dutch border controls. From 2024 different customs rules will apply. For example, you cannot bring meat, fish or dairy products with you from the UK to the Netherlands, although there are some exceptions.
